Definitions
Wiktionary
- v. idiomatic, US, Canada, colloquial To be very impressive.
- v. idiomatic, US, Canada, colloquial To beat someone in a competition, fight, or other situation.
- interj. slang Used to express happiness or a feeling of accomplishment.
